Partial Bochdalek's herniation; computerized tomographic evaluation
Chest
|May 1, 1980
Abstract:
The advent of computerized tomographic scanning has provided an accurate and noninvasive method for the diagnosis of suspected, small, partial diaphragmatic herniations.
